Topaz Labs recently unveiled its new Lens Effects plug-in for Photoshop. Lens Effects allows you to apply depth of field effects and other effects to your images during post processing. Lens Effects uses a depth map for fine tuning out of focus areas, which helps make the depth of field look more natural and optical-based. [Read more…]

Canon Radio TTL Flash Coming Soon, DSLR w/ Radio Transmitter Too?
Canon may be making that radio trigger flash and DSLR with a built-in transmitter after all. Recall that I posted the details on Canon’s patent application in August 2010, which covered a radio-signal transmitter and receiver communication between DSLR and Speedlights.
Now Canon Rumors says its been told that Canon has working prototypes of flashes that are triggered via radio communication by an updated version of the ST-E2 transmitter. Presumably, any new flash from Canon that sports built-in radio TTL communication would unseat the 580 EX II as the flagship Speedlight in Canon’s lineup. [Read more…]

Zeiss Distagon T 35mm F/1.4 ZF.2 Lens Available for Pre-Order
B&H Photo has posted that the Zeiss Distagon T 35mm F/1.4 ZF.2 lens is now available for pre-order for the Nikon F Mount version. Here’s the link.
As is custom at B&H, when something is posted for pre-order, it generally means that stock is on the way and almost ready to ship out to customers. No word on the Canon version yet.
